d5900813 05/18/2010 10:23 pm Alexander Graf

target-s390: enable SIGP Initial Reset

For SMP to work with KVM, we need to properly emulate the SIGP Initial Reset
Command. Recent (2.6.32) kernels issue that before the SIGP Reset command that
actually wakes up the vcpu.

This patch makes -smp work on S390x....

d4c430a8 03/17/2010 04:44 am Paul Brook

Large page TLB flush

QEMU uses a fixed page size for the CPU TLB. If the guest uses large
pages then we effectively split these into multiple smaller pages, and
populate the corresponding TLB entries on demand.

When the guest invalidates the TLB by virtual address we must invalidate...

0e60a699 12/05/2009 06:36 pm Alexander Graf

Add KVM support for S390x

S390x was one of the first platforms that received support for KVM back in the
day. Unfortunately until now there hasn't been a qemu implementation that would
enable users to actually run guests.

So let's include support for KVM S390x in qemu!...
